some flood cars cannot be resold. they get branded titles. "THEY ALL SHOULD" > the selling salvage yards bring crews in to clean and recondition the cars because many go over seas. Just because a car runs and drives does not say anything for a car that's been In a flood. Corrosion kicks in on ALL electrical parts. even if just the carpets get wet. They cannot remove all the moisture I n the car unless it is completely taken apart and every part dried ,cleaned inspected. When a car with moisture sits in the hot Texas and Florida sun for a month or two that moisture gets into everything. The car is sealed and the sun draws the moisture into every crack and crevice. These cars sat in water for days before being moved. Gm builds car to be dry in rain and driving but summer a part in water for several days and it can easily leak. Even parts that appear clean have been subjected to salt and brackish water. Its not just raining into a car. Its polluted water.And yes if you break down a car that was worth 20k$ maybe not 50k As you asked.. it will not bring near as much with a branded title as it will in parts. Not to say that some few cars can be bought cleaned parts replaced etc .One owner on here was talking about a shallow flood car that he bought and after 4 months started having all sorts of electrical problems. He took the wiring harness out and there was corrosion all over it. every plug that was wrapped had rust/corrosion. seat motors , seat tracks all are not even painted from the factory or have very little paint . They will rust when wet. Both of the cars listed had flood markings required by insurance companies before sale that showed water almost to the xlr emblems on the fenders..
